A _______ is caused, as in the 2004 indian ocean tidal wave disaster, when active tectonic plate margins create volcanic eruptio

ns and earthquakes.
a. tsunami
b. hurricane
c. typhoon
d. monsoon

The correct answer is - a. tsunami.

The tsunami is a result of the volcanic and earthquake activity on the plate boundaries in the ocean. It forms when there's a big disturbance in the oceanic crust, and from all the force and stress released, the water is becoming very turbulent.

At first, the waters of the ocean/sea are dragged towards the crack where the volcanic or earthquake activity appeared, and after that, under enormous pressure the water is pushed out again. The water now has very big speed and very big power. As it nears the shore it creates huge waves, and once these waves reach the land they destroy most things in front of them.
